The Rich Tradition of Potatoes in Indian Cuisine

Potatoes play a very significant role in Indian cooking. They were introduced from overseas in the 16th century. But, soon they became an integral part of most traditional Indian dishes.

Potatoes are excellent at absorbing spices. This is why they are ideal for Indian cuisine. They flavor and fill up big and small meals.

How Potatoes Became a Staple in Indian Cooking

Potatoes migrated from South America to India. Indian farmers adored them since they could grow well and provided much food. They became a staple when there was no grain.

Regional Significance of Potato Dishes Across India

Various regions in India have their own potato recipes. In the north, aloo paratha and potato curries are favorites. In the east, potatoes are combined with mustard seeds and poppy paste.

In the west, there is batata vada and pav bhaji. The south incorporates potatoes in dosas and sambar. Potatoes are cooked differently in every region.

Essential Spices and Ingredients for Indian Potato Dishes

Begin with the spices in order to prepare authentic Indian potato recipes. The trick begins when you blend aromatic spices together with potatoes. Cumin seeds, mustard seeds, turmeric, and red chili powder serve as the foundation for most preparations.

The variety of potato used is crucial in Indian cuisine. Waxy potatoes retain their shape in curries. Starchy potatoes are ideal for mashing. Red potatoes work well for Bombay Potatoes, and russets are ideal for Aloo Tikki.

Aloo Gobi: Cauliflower and Potato Harmony

This recipe combines potatoes and cauliflower in the best way. They’re fried with minimal moisture to crisp and absorb spices. Frying them until slightly tender maintains their textures.

Bombay Potatoes: The Street Food Sensation

This recipe includes crispy fried potato cubes with a colorful spice blend. Potatoes are par-boiled and then shallow-fried. The finishing touch is adding aromatic spices towards the end.

Dum Aloo: Whole Potatoes in Rich Gravy

Small potatoes are pan-fried and then cooked in a rich yogurt gravy. The “dum” process cooks them slowly in a covered pot. This allows the potatoes to soak up the sauce, making the dish rich.

Aloo Tikki: Spiced Potato Patties

These patties combine mashed potatoes with spices and occasionally peas or lentils. They’re pan-fried until crispy on the outside and soft on the inside. Served with chutneys, they demonstrate why potato dishes are so popular.

South Indian Potato Specialties Worth Mastering

North Indian potato foods are characterized by strong spices. However, South Indian food incorporates coconut, mustard seeds, and curry leaves. This gives their potato foods distinctive flavor.

Masala Dosa with Potato Filling

The masala dosa is one of the most popular dishes. It consists of a crispy crepe made from rice and lentils with a spiced potato filling. The filling consists of turmeric-yellow potatoes, green chilies, mustard seeds, curry leaves.

The crunchy dosa and soft interior make it a breakfast favorite in India.

Kerala Potato Stew with Coconut

Kerala potato stew is a favorite because of its harmonious flavors. It consists of potatoes in coconut milk, black pepper, cardamom, and cloves. It’s light but filling, perfect with appam or idiappam.

Potato Podimas: A Simple Tamil Delight

Potato podimas is an easy South Indian dish. It’s boiled potatoes mashed and spiced with curry leaves, mustard seeds, turmeric, and urad dal. It’s a versatile dish that can be served with rice, dosa, or idli.

15-Minute Jeera Aloo (Cumin Potatoes)

This recipe has a lot of flavor with little ingredients. The trick is to bloom cumin seeds in hot oil until fragrant. Preboil potatoes in advance and store them in the fridge on busy nights.

Add garam masala and fresh cilantro towards the end. This yields a simple and delicious spicy potato dish that is great with flatbreads.

Simple Potato Curry in a Hurry

This is a speedy potato curry recipe that does not compromise on flavor. Frozen chopped onions and ginger-garlic paste save preparation time. Simmering time reduces to 5 minutes by using a pressure cooker from the traditional 30 minutes.

Employ readymade curry powder to gain instant flavor. Make a reduction in chili powder according to personal preference but retain the true taste. Complete with lemon juice for a flash of freshness.

Microwave Potato Bharta

This quick mashed potato recipe takes less than 10 minutes. The microwave preserves the potatoes’ moisture. Microwave pierced potatoes until soft, then mash with sautéed onions, green chilies, and spices.

Microwaving makes the potatoes rich and creamy. Enjoy with naan or roti for a great meal

Protein-Packed Potato and Lentil Dishes

Legumes and potatoes go well together. Aloo Chana combines chickpeas with potatoes in a tomato sauce. Masoor Dal with potatoes constitutes a filling meal with minimal fat.

Air Fryer Indian Potato Innovations

The air fryer prepares healthier potato recipes with less oil. Spiced potato cubes air-fried using a small amount of mustard oil are crunchy like Jeera Aloo but with fewer fats. Even Aloo Bonda, traditionally fried, can be air-fried at 370°F for 12 minutes in chickpea flour.
